1、In which ones of the following ways can motor vehicle drivers effectively prevent braking failure?
A、Maintaining the braking system periodically
B、Checking the free brake pedal travel before driving
C、Using the braking system correctly to avoid brake-fade
D、For vehicles with hydraulic braking system, checking if the brake fluid leaks before driving
Answer:ABCD

7、When there is a sudden braking failure on the road, what should be done by the driver?
A、Firmly holding the steering wheel and controlling the direction
B、Immediately changing to a low gear to reduce speed
C、Using the stopping brake to reduce speed
D、Turning on the hazard lamps
Answer:ABCD
8、When a motor vehicle breaks down and has to be stopped on the highway, what should the driver do?
A、Set up a breakdown warning sign 150 meters behind the vehicle
B、Set up a breakdown warning sign 100 meters behind the vehicle
C、If it happens at night, turn on the clearance lamp and rear position lamp
D、Turn on the hazard lamps
Answer:ACD

11、How to ensure motor vehicles have sufficient power when driving uphill?
A、Downshift before reducing speed
B、Downshift after reducing speed
C、Downshift when the speed is excessively low
D、Downshift to the fullest extent
Answer:A
12、When a motor vehicle moves through water, drivers should intermittently and gently depress the brake pedal in order to restore braking efficiency.
A、Right
B、Wrong
Answer:A
